Output 868fbc29ed4a20fba89fd124aad70748d889ff001a9e11554fb72142275591e8:1

value
2083800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90cd34f1713bc58ed35b774d861299d68b5991f2 OP_EQUAL
address
3Etf4BmGterEtHFZMVya5gRqC8yBkG5ZQG
transaction
868fbc29ed4a20fba89fd124aad70748d889ff001a9e11554fb72142275591e8
confirmations
353797
spent
true